September 21 st, 2022
Resolution: Nicholas Senn High School Class of 1957's 65th Reunion
WHEREAS, The members of the City Council of Chicago wish to recognize the many accomplishments and the 65th reunion of the Nicholas Senn High School's Class of 1957; and
WHEREAS, the Senn High School Class of 1957 will reunite on September 21st, in honor of the 65th anniversary of their graduation; and
WHEREAS, The City Council has been notified of this reunion by the Honorable Harry Osterman, Alderman of the 48th Ward; and
WHEREAS, the Senn High School class of 1957 has stayed connected since their graduation 65 years ago, a remarkable testament to the unifying friendship and community fostered by their education at Nicholas Senn High School; and
WHEREAS, alumni of Senn High School have continued their connection to the school by supporting the arts programs, which initiated a connection with current Senn Students, from the class of 2023 to the class of 2026, to be involved in this reunion; and
WHEREAS, a cover band comprised of current Senn High School students, including students in the Electroacoustic Performance Pathway program, an enriching new program established with the goals of collaboration and immersion in contemporary music-making strategies, will take part in the celebration of this reunion; and
WHEREAS, musicians from Senn will be led by Trevor Nicholas, the director of vocal ensembles at Senn High School and a finalist for the 2022 Music Educator GRAMMY Award, who continues his meaningful work by engaging students with the cutting edge of musical innovation; and
WHEREAS, the 65th reunion of the Senn class of 1957 will be an opportunity for alumni to gather in fellowship and reminiscence as they celebrate their time at Senn High School alongside another generation of remarkable Senn students; and
BE IT RESOLVED, That we, the Mayor and the members ofthe City Council ofthe City of Chicago, gathered here this day of September 21st, 2022 do hereby express our congratulations to the Nicholas Senn High School class of 1957 on their 65th reunion, and extend to the alumni, their family, and friends our hope for a meaningful celebration; and
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, That suitable copies of this resolution be printed to the alumni organizers of this reunion as a token of our celebration.
Harry Osterman Alderman, 48th Ward
